Description
Summary:The objective of this project is to design and implement a cascade boost converter with different feedback controllers. The aim is to regulate the output voltage of the converter in the presence of load changes, desired voltage changes and input voltage changes. There are two controllers used in this project – Non-adaptive current-mode controller and adaptive current-mode controller. Different tests are conducted to analyse the performance of each controller and the results are presented and discussed. Finally, a comparison is conducted to recommend the better controller for the cascade boost converter.
